In The Practice of Not Thinking, Ryunosuke Koike reveals a powerful approach rooted in Zen philosophy to help you clear your mind, focus on the present, and find inner peace. 📌 Chapters:
Introduction: Learn how to think less and appreciate more.
1. Silencing your thoughts unlocks clarity
2. Inner peace comes when you learn to acknowledge emotions without reacting to them
3. The world changes when you open your ears to its sounds
4. To cultivate the art of seeing, avoid strong images
5. Focusing on your sense of touch can help you regain your concentration
